At-Talaq 65:3

Juz 28 · Page 558

وَيَرْزُقْهُ مِنْ حَيْثُ لَا يَحْتَسِبُ وَمَن يَتَوَكَّلْ عَلَى ٱللَّهِ فَهُوَ حَسْبُهُۥٓ إِنَّ ٱللَّهَ بَٰلِغُ أَمْرِهِۦ قَدْ جَعَلَ ٱللَّهُ لِكُلِّ شَىْءٍ قَدْرًا ٣

And will provide for him from where he does not expect. And whoever relies upon Allah - then He is sufficient for him. Indeed, Allah will accomplish His purpose. Allah has already set for everything a [decreed] extent.

Revelation context of the surah

Surah-wide

Surah at-Talaq is Medinan, revealed in the period when family law was being regulated in Medina. It lays down that divorce is to be pronounced with regard to the waiting period, fixes the lengths of the idda, and secures the divorced woman's rights to housing and maintenance. Reports connect the application of these rulings to concrete cases such as Ibn Umar divorcing his wife during her menses; the surah frames the law of divorce within God-consciousness.
